Patients taking antacids should be educated regarding these drugs, including letting them know that:
- A. They may cause constipation or diarrhea
- B. Many are high in sodium
- C. They should separate antacids from other medications by 1 hour
- D. All of the above
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: All are true: antacids cause GI effects , may be high-sodium , and interact with drugs if not timed apart .

Which medication order requires nursing judgment and means administer if needed?
- A. Morphine 4 mg IV stat
- B. Morphine 4 mg IV prior to procedure
- C. Morphine 4 mg IV four times a day
- D. Morphine 4 mg IV every 4 hours PRN
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: PRN indicates for the nurse to administer morphine every 4 hours if needed and requires nursing judgment. Stat means the dose of morphine would be given immediately, not as needed. The orders for the dose of morphine to be given prior to the patient's scheduled procedure and four times a day, do not indicate to give the dose as needed.

A nurse is caring for a client who has been taking Sertraline for the past 2 days. Which of the following assessment findings should alert the nurse to the possibility that the client is developing Serotonin syndrome?
- A. Bruising
- B. Fever
- C. Abdominal pain
- D. Rash
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Fever is a key sign of serotonin syndrome, a potentially life-threatening condition from SSRI overdose.
While receiving treatment for kidney stones, a man complains of swelling and pain in his big toe and is found to have hyperuricemia
- A. Clomiphene
- B. Hydrochlorothiazide
- C. Furosemide
- D. Mifepristone
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Thiazides like hydrochlorothiazide reduce uric acid excretion, causing hyperuricemia and gout.
